John Vater QC in Re E concerning parental responsibility and artificial reproduction


4th Feb 2015 | News


John Vater QC appeared for the father in this case involving home donation of sperm. The mother was a homosexual woman and had met the father on a website called coparentmatch.com. A child was born to the parties in 2010. Contact agreements broke down after the father began to present himself and the mother as though they were in a heterosexual relationship.

The father applied for contact and a parental responsibility order.

Hayden J made important observations about parental responsibility in artificial reproduction cases. He concluded his judgment with a plea for the word ‘donor’ to be expunged from the ‘lexicon of family law.’
